You can pair a tiny wireless mic to this 4K webcam

News RoomBy News Room16 December 2025Updated:16 December 2025No Comments
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
You can pair a tiny wireless mic to this 4K webcam
You can pair a tiny wireless mic to this 4K webcam

Hollyland, a company best known for affordable wireless microphones that are popular with creators, has announced its first webcam, the small 4K Lyra. While it lacks advanced features like the Insta360 Link’s tracking gimbal, it’s one of the first webcams we’ve seen that’s designed to improve how you sound by connecting directly to one of Hollyland’s wireless lav mics.

The Lyra features a built-in receiver for Hollyland’s Lark A1 wireless microphone that includes AI-powered noise reduction. It’s not as small as the Lark M2S microphone the company announced earlier this year, but it will definitely be an upgrade over the mic built into your …
